Proxsee: Anti-Spoofing Web-Based Application Attendance Monitoring System Using Face Liveness And Google's Facenet

Abstract

Authentication is one of the significant issues in the era of information system. Current biometric methods for attendance are too intrusive. Among other things, human face Recognition (HFR)is one of known techniques which can be used for user authentication. As an important branch of biometric verification, HFR has been widely used in many applications, Such as video monitoring/surveillance system, human-computer interaction, door access control system and network security. This paper presents a stress-free non- intrusive way of taking class attendance using face as the biometric. Proxsee has a reliable anti-spoofing facial recognition system that utilizes different convolutional neural network (CNN) of Face Liveness and Face Recognition based on Google's FaceNet. ProxSeee must contain vigorous algorithm that is capable of enrolling faces to the system, identifying presentation attacks and recognizing faces matched from the database. To utilize its main functionalities, it must be run on a server with a camera that will identify attacks and monitor student attendance. To do this, the system will be set up beside the ae entrance door of a classroom and comprise of a web camera and computer. Upon taking attendance, as soon as the system detects any form of presentation attacks, it'll prompt back to rescanning. Also, recognition is limited in the frontal face. Results shows that 8/10 attempts of spoof attacks are being detected by the system. Unfortunately, only 2/10 enrolled people are being recognized correctly. Data logging is working perfectly.
